How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Main Patrick Henry?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Main Patrick Henry Studio Apartments | $1,490 | $790 | $1,925 |
Main Patrick Henry 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,426 | $938 | $2,263 |
Main Patrick Henry 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,215 | $765 | $2,533 |
Main Patrick Henry 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,337 | $750 | $2,835 |
Main Patrick Henry 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,200 | $500 | $3,913 |

Getting Around the Main Patrick Henry Neighborhood in Blacksburg, VA
Walk Score®
50 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
60 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
36 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
